Oyo State Commandant Iskilu Akinsanya of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ps today warn all the indigine and resident of Ogbomoso including other parts of Oyo State not to take law into their hand when they can enjoy the benefits of Alternative Dispute Resolution from the Command Peace and Conflict Resolution Unit.
He made this known today at the Command Headquarters Agodi Ibadan while addressing Armed men going for show of force in preparation for the Saturday Local government elections in the State. Four suspects arrested by the Agro Rangers squad in Ogbomoso axis of the Oyo State after a distress call was made by the chairman Ogbomoso Meyatti Allah, Alhaji Mahmud Muhammed for intervention in a serious fight at Ayanyan Kara market Ogbomoso between the Fulani people.
It was reliably gathered that the fight between the family of Alhaji Mumuni of Alata Village Ogbomoso North and Mr Daka Adamu of Idi Igba Village Ogbomoso North which started last Saturday 15th May,2021 at Okonjo area Ogbomoso North where two member of Daka family sustained injury. Following this it was alleged that Daka family invited their relatives from Gambari in Surulere Local Government for reprisal attack yesterday Wednesday 19/5/2021.
However the intervention of Agro Rangers squad doused the tension and four (4) suspects have been arrested in connection with the incident. They were Isiaka Abdulmumini male, 25yrs, Adamu Musa, male, 65yrs, Saliu Yusuf male, 20yrs and Muhammed Abdullahi male, 18yrs.
The other four victims who sustained various degree of injury rescued by the Agro Rangers have been taken to LAUTECH Teaching Hospital for treatment. They are Umaru Mumini male, 45yrs,of Alata Village, Isiaka Usman male,30yrs, from Gambari Oloya Village, Muhammadu Jamiu male,25yrs, of Alata Village and Hassan Yakubu male, 40yrs of Erita Village. Exhibits recovered from the suspects includes 3 Machet, 1 stick, 3 Techno Phone and a sum of #34,700 (Thirty four thousand seven hundred naira only.
Commandant Iskilu Akinsanya warns against violence in any form in Oyo State as NSCDC will not treat anybody involve in crime and criminality with kid glove. He appreciate the Chairman Ogbomoso Miyetti Allah for the call and encourage all the good people of the State to volunteer information to nip crime in the bud and promised that the identity of volunteers will remain confidential.
Meanwhile, as the same case have already reported to the Police Area Command where the crisis occurred, the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Ogbomoso Area Command have transferred the case to the Area Police Command despite the fact that NSCDC rescue the situation.
